Why 31,000 Kaiser Permanente Employees Are Hanging — Once more

Roughly 31,000 Kaiser Permanente nurses and different healthcare professionals are planning to launch an open-ended strike beginning on Monday.

Their most important grievances are continual understaffing, rising workloads and issues that Kaiser’s wage and contract proposals fail to handle cost-of-living pressures.

The employees occurring strike are represented primarily by the United Nurses Associations of California/Union of Well being Care Professionals (UNAC/UHCP). Their strike will have an effect on  20 hospitals and 200 clinics throughout California and Hawaii.

Kaiser mentioned it plans for its amenities to remain open however is warning of disruptions, rescheduled appointments and attainable pharmacy closures.

This week, the well being system launched a assertion saying nationwide labor negotiations have stalled regardless of what it referred to as important progress and a “historic” wage proposal, blaming unions for bad-faith techniques and disruptions to the bargaining course of. 

Kaiser acknowledged that shifting unresolved points to native negotiations is essentially the most sensible option to attain agreements on pay and advantages.

The unions body the strike as a affected person security and workforce retention disaster, not only a pay combat. They argue that low staffing ranges and mounting administrative pressures are already delaying care — forcing clinicians to chop again providers and, in some circumstances, depart the group altogether. 

One union member — Cameron Cook dinner, a nurse anesthetist at Kaiser’s hospital in Redwood Metropolis, California — famous that Kaiser has not negotiated in good religion and has tried to painting union employees as grasping whereas avoiding critical bargaining. 

He mentioned clinicians will not be looking for main monetary positive aspects however are combating to protect current advantages and protections that Kaiser is now attempting to roll again, regardless of claims of beneficiant wage will increase.

“Whereas Kaiser does push this concept that they’re providing a really beneficiant wage improve, they’re hiding the truth that they’re truly attempting to chop a whole lot of our advantages and retirement and healthcare, in addition to our potential to manage our personal scheduling,” Cook dinner declared.

He additionally identified that the dispute is a affected person care difficulty and highlighted how staffing shortages result in delayed appointments, canceled surgical procedures and poor communication.

He has witnessed these issues as each as a supplier and as a affected person member of the family. 

“I’ve a baby who has a everlasting incapacity, so we’re always going to Kaiser. I see what the sufferers face on that finish, by way of delayed or canceled appointments, and the shortcoming to get a response or speak to a human. She lately had a significant surgical procedure, and we had been by no means capable of get in for her three-month observe up. We finally simply needed to cease attempting as a result of nobody would get again to us,” Cook dinner acknowledged.

Finally, he thinks employees nonetheless consider in Kaiser’s mission however fear the group is drifting towards company priorities on the expense of sufferers and frontline workers. 

He warned that if Kaiser continues down its present path, the hole between its acknowledged values and day-to-day realities for sufferers and clinicians will solely widen.

“We do like Kaiser. We consider in Kaiser. I believe by way of healthcare within the U.S., Kaiser’s mannequin is to be admired — however we’re beginning to see company pursuits creep in, and admittedly, they’re shedding their approach. We need to see Kaiser put money into affected person care and the suppliers who present that care,” Cook dinner remarked.

Such a labor dispute is nothing new for Kaiser. This similar group of 31,000 employees went on strike as lately as October, after they walked out for 5 days over issues associated to staffing, wages and affected person care.
